Transaction e521f5f4837912fc7b7e47e21916541304bdcb2799da1f01fb1a04b091a79dad
1 Input
2 Outputs
- e521f5f4837912fc7b7e47e21916541304bdcb2799da1f01fb1a04b091a79dad:0
- e521f5f4837912fc7b7e47e21916541304bdcb2799da1f01fb1a04b091a79dad:1
value 100000000
address 32xHDkGq8JorLKPoPw3GUBehr1hooiK9RL
value 101038592
address 3BMEXGWGqDJRpr9r4v85CqUyKGcqwisThi